Output 35babc5992159e4150388bb7a40be71216be3303806d10ab6c79ce6afb1d8a11:1

value
677837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d47d1ee6d218d53e3e98e6005e2dddffbdfca7f OP_EQUAL
address
37H3BPYnAPW3y54ZFK7whYgxjCZ1XCHkVQ
transaction
35babc5992159e4150388bb7a40be71216be3303806d10ab6c79ce6afb1d8a11
spent
true